void DisposeRadApi() { if (_api == null) return; _api.TagFound -= Api_TagFound; _api.NoTagFound -= Api_NoTagFound; try { _api.Dispose(); } catch { Debug.WriteLine("Error at _api.Dispose()"); } _api = null; }
void CreateRadApi() { if (_api != null) DisposeRadApi(); _api = new RadApi(_writeKey); _api.TagFound += Api_TagFound; _api.NoTagFound += Api_NoTagFound; }